Souvenirs de jeunesse is a journey through time spanning two centuries, from 1774 to 1980. From David to Delacroix, from Gérôme to Cézanne, from Matisse to Gina Pane, the Beaux-Arts de Paris collection will be showcased, with a look back at the singular careers of famous artists who passed through the School, as well as evoking the Prix de Rome, their stay at the Villa Médicis and the various academic movements.

The Beaux-Arts de Paris collection is the result of historic donations from artists, teachers and students, as well as generous collectors, who are keen to pass on important groups of works to future generations of artists.

Scheduled to run from October 2024 to January 2025, this exceptional event will be held in the Palais des Beaux-Arts, opposite the Louvre Museum.
